零代码反应慢怎么解决
-
零代码平台在使用过程中出现反应慢的情况可能是由多种因素引起的。以下是一些可能的解决方法:
-
优化数据结构和算法:设计良好的数据结构和使用高效的算法可以显著提高应用程序的性能。确保您在零代码平台上使用最佳的数据结构和算法,以减少处理时间。
-
减少数据查询:大量的数据查询是导致零代码应用程序反应慢的常见原因之一。尽量减少不必要的数据查询,可以通过优化数据库查询来减少对数据库的访问次数。
-
使用缓存:将常用的数据缓存起来,以减少对数据库的访问,提高数据的读取速度。缓存可以减少数据查询的次数,从而加快应用程序的响应速度。
-
异步处理任务:将一些耗时的任务设置为异步处理,避免阻塞应用程序的主线程。这样可以确保应用程序在处理这些任务的同时能够继续响应其他请求,提高整体的响应速度。
-
优化前端界面:优化前端界面可以提高用户体验,包括尽量减少不必要的UI元素和降低页面加载时间。通过减少前端资源的加载量和优化页面布局,可以加快页面显示速度,提高用户的操作效率。
通过以上方法的应用,可以有效地解决零代码平台反应慢的问题,提升应用程序的性能和用户体验。
5个月前 -
-
概述
在进行软件开发时,零代码平台可以帮助开发人员在不编写代码的情况下快速构建应用程序。然而,有时候使用零代码平台可能会导致应用程序的响应速度较慢。这种情况可能是由于平台本身的性能问题、应用设计不当、网络延迟等原因造成的。为了解决零代码应用程序响应慢的问题,可以从优化方法、操作流程等方面着手,下面将详细介绍具体的解决方法。
优化方法
1. 数据库优化
- 索引优化:确保数据库表中的常用字段都有适当的索引,以加快数据查询速度。
- 数据表拆分:将大型数据表拆分为多个小型表,减少查询负载。
- 缓存策略:使用缓存技术,减少数据库访问次数,提高数据读取速度。
2. 前端优化
- 减少网络请求:合并和压缩前端资源文件,减少页面加载时间。
- 懒加载:延迟加载页面的某些元素,在需要时再进行加载,减少初始加载时间。
- 图片优化:使用合适尺寸和格式的图片,减小页面加载负担。
3. 后端优化
- 代码优化:尽可能减少不必要的代码执行和重复操作。
- 缓存策略:采用缓存技术缓存计算结果或频繁访问的数据,减少后端计算负担。
操作流程
1. 检查数据库性能
- 使用数据库性能工具:使用专业的数据库性能分析工具,检查数据库查询性能、索引使用情况等。
- 优化 SQL 查询:优化慢查询、避免全表扫描等,提高数据库查询速度。
- 查看数据库连接情况:确保数据库连接数足够,避免连接过多导致负载过高。
2. 分析前端性能
- 使用前端性能分析工具:通过工具分析页面性能,找出影响页面加载速度的因素。
- 压缩前端资源:将 CSS、JavaScript 文件进行压缩和合并,减少页面加载时间。
- 懒加载优化:调整页面元素的加载时机,减少初始加载请求。
3. 检查后端逻辑
- 代码审查:检查后端代码逻辑,避免不必要的重复计算或逻辑错误导致应用反应缓慢。
- 缓存策略:根据业务需求使用合适的缓存策略,减少后端查询负载。
4. 监控与调优
- 实时监控系统性能:使用监控工具对系统性能进行实时监控,及时发现性能问题。
- 持续优化:根据监控数据和用户反馈进行持续优化,提高应用程序响应速度。
结论
通过数据库优化、前端优化、后端优化以及监控与调优等操作流程,可以有效提高零代码应用程序的响应速度,提升用户体验。在实际操作中,建议结合具体业务场景和应用需求,采取针对性的优化措施,持续关注应用性能,保持应用高效稳定运行。
5个月前 -
零代码平台反应慢可能是由多种因素造成的,下面将从多个方面进行分析,提供解决方法。
-
优化前端页面
首先,可以从前端页面入手进行优化。压缩图片、减少页面 HTTP 请求数量、优化 JavaScript 和 CSS 代码,以加快前端页面加载速度。
-
数据库优化
如果零代码平台使用了数据库,可以对数据库进行调优。优化查询语句、索引、表结构,以及考虑缓存技术的应用,以提高数据读取和更新的效率。
-
提升后台服务性能
深入分析后台服务的性能瓶颈,可以考虑进行服务端代码的优化、增加服务端资源,或者引入负载均衡技术,以提升后台服务的性能和响应速度。
-
缓存机制
引入缓存机制,如使用 Redis 等内存缓存数据库,将常用数据缓存起来,减少对数据库的频繁访问,提升数据检索速度。
-
代码质量
对平台现有的代码进行性能优化和重构,提高代码质量,减少不必要的性能消耗,从而提升整体系统的响应速度。
-
监控和调优
使用监控工具对系统进行定期监控,找出性能瓶颈并进行调优,保证系统稳定且高效地运行。
-
水平扩展
考虑通过增加服务器节点、使用负载均衡器等手段进行系统的水平扩展,以提高系统的并发处理能力和响应速度。
在进行这些优化的过程中,需要综合考虑系统的整体架构和性能瓶颈,结合实际情况有针对性地进行改进,以提升零代码平台的响应速度和用户体验。
5个月前 -